Starting a new corporation can be daunting, but with our 10 essential New Corporation Do’s and Don’ts guide, you can navigate the challenges and build a successful business.
Do’s:
- Do create a business plan – This will help you to set goals, allocate resources, and stay on track.
- Do hire an experienced accountant and lawyer – They will help you to comply with tax laws, create a solid legal foundation for your business, and avoid costly mistakes.
- Do register your business with the appropriate government agencies – This will allow you to operate legally and take advantage of any tax breaks and incentives.
- Do establish a strong online presence – In today’s digital age, having a website, social media accounts, and other online tools is crucial to reaching potential customers.
- Do set up a separate bank account for your business – This will help you keep track of your finances and make it easier to file taxes.
- Do create a marketing plan – This will help you to reach your target audience and build brand awareness.
- Do track your expenses and revenue – This will help you to identify areas where you can cut costs and improve profitability.
- Do invest in professional development – This will help you to stay up-to-date on industry trends and improve your skills as a business owner.
- Do network with other entrepreneurs – This can help you to learn from their experiences and build valuable business connections.
- Do stay organized and focused – Running a successful business requires discipline, hard work, and the ability to stay focused on your goals.
Don’ts:
- Don’t neglect legal compliance – Ignoring legal requirements can lead to fines, penalties, and even legal action.
- Don’t overspend on unnecessary expenses – Keeping costs under control is essential to ensuring long-term profitability.
- Don’t ignore your customers – Building strong relationships with your customers is essential to building a successful business.
- Don’t forget to pay your taxes – Failure to pay taxes can lead to serious legal and financial consequences.
- Don’t neglect cybersecurity – As more business is conducted online, cybersecurity threats are increasing, and it’s important to take steps to protect your business and customer data.
- Don’t neglect employee training – Investing in employee training can help you to build a strong, motivated workforce.
- Don’t make hasty decisions – Taking the time to carefully consider your options and weigh the pros and cons of each decision can help you to make better choices in the long run.
- Don’t neglect your personal life – Running a business can be all-consuming, but it’s important to make time for family, friends, and hobbies.
- Don’t ignore negative feedback – Listening to and addressing negative feedback can help you to improve your business and build stronger relationships with your customers.
- Don’t ignore the competition – Keeping an eye on your competitors can help you to identify areas where you can improve and stay ahead of the curve.
